I picked up my fresh sausage from Lagneaux's last week. 60% deer, 25% chicken thighs, 15% ribeye fat. I had them season it medium. They offer mild, medium, med. hot, and hot. I put some on my pit last night with woodie breast stuffed with cream cheese and mesquite seasoning. I didn't have any bacon so I used my tenderizing hammer and pounded out the duck breast, put cream cheese and seasoning and toothpicked it. Man that was so tender and good. We enjoyed the sausage and it was juicy and not dry. I think next time I will have them add green onions and jalapenos. Very nice folks over there and a very nice operation they have setup. I brought them 10 lbs. deboned and I got back 16 lbs. fresh sausage for $44.33 The price list goes like this:
Vacuum Pack 1.35 lb. includes deboning, if it is deboned already 1.05 lb.
Fresh sausage .75 lb
Smoke sausage 1.25 lb
Green onions .25 lb
Pork 2.59 lb
Chicken 2.69 lb
Brisket 3.29 lb
Ribeye Fat 4.89 lb
Jalapeno .30 lb
